How Much Does a Skoda Replacement Key Cost?
The cost of a new key is determined by the kind of vehicle and the locksmith. Laser-cut optical keys are the most common and cost around $150 per key. These keys come with an embedded transponder chip which must be programmed by a locksmith, or at the dealership.
The cost of replacing the modern car keys is a lot. Choice is an Australian consumer advocacy group, secretly contacted 22 dealerships to determine prices that ranged from $70 to $500.

Cost of a remote Key
The cost of remotes for your Skoda depends on the quality and type of materials. Generally, keys made from higher-quality materials cost more. The key shaft as well as the integrated fob play a part in the cost of replacing the key. The key must also be programmed so that it works with the immobilizer. This can be done by the dealer or a locksmith.

If you're in search of a standard cylinder key or an optical laser cut key, a locksmith can offer the right solution to meet your budget and needs. The typical cost for an entirely new key is from $25 to $100. The cost can vary based on the type of key and the location where it was purchased.
